MS PowerPoint Basic
Duration
3 hours
(short-format workshop)
Design Clear and Effective Presentations
Learn to build engaging and well-structured presentations using Microsoft PowerPoint.
What You'll Learn
- Navigating the PowerPoint interface
- Creating and editing slides
- Text, bullet points, and basic formatting
- Using themes and slide layouts
- Inserting images, icons, and shapes
- Running and printing a presentation
Who Should Take This Course
Perfect for beginners, students, or anyone presenting ideas clearly.
Course Format
- Live virtual delivery
- In-person sessions available for academic or workplace groups
- Practice building sample presentations
MS PowerPoint Intermediate
Duration
3 hours
(can be split into shorter modules)
Elevate Your Visual Storytelling
This course helps you create polished, dynamic presentations that captivate and inform.
What You'll Learn
- Working with slide masters and layouts
- SmartArt and custom graphics
- Inserting and editing charts and tables
- Using transitions and animations effectively
- Audio/video integration
- Presenter view and slideshow tools
Who Should Take This Course
Ideal for professionals, educators, and team leads who present regularly.
Course Format
- Virtual or in-person instruction
- Focused on building real presentation decks
MS PowerPoint Advanced
Duration
6 hours
(modular or full-day option)
Design High-Impact, Professional Presentations
Master the art of delivering data-driven, customized, and interactive PowerPoint presentations.
What You'll Learn
- Advanced animation and timing sequences
- Embedding interactive elements and hyperlinks
- Custom slide shows and navigation menus
- Designing for audience engagement and accessibility
- Branding and template standardization
- Exporting presentations to PDF, video, or web formats
Who Should Take This Course
Trainers, executives, consultants, and marketing professionals.
Course Format
- Project-based virtual sessions
- In-person workshops for teams building branded decks or conference content
- Real feedback on slide design and delivery
